Now in its 34th year, Richmond Yacht Club Sail A Small Boat Day is a free and informal gathering, open to anyone who wants to attend – sailors and non-sailors, young and old alike.
Richmond Yacht Club ask that people bring their own PFDs and warm clothing, but RYC do provide PFDs as needed, in all sizes.
RYC is hosting this event to connect people in the Bay area with small boat sailing. We expect that as many as 200 people may attend throughout the day. The club provides a free hot dog lunch for you and all who show up.
This is great event to try sailing a small boat. Bring your family as its open for kids too. If you plan to sail in a single handed boat by yourself, bring a towel, a change of clothes and wear a swimsuit under your clothes as some of these boat do tip over.
But in general you can ride along, in many boats, with an experienced skipper and they will not tip the boat over.
